Coordinating international flight traffic is a complex task that requires meticulous planning and cooperation among various agencies and countries. Efficient procedures ensure safety, punctuality, and smooth operations across borders.
Key Procedures for Effective Coordination
To manage international flight traffic effectively, several procedures are commonly followed by aviation authorities, airlines, and air traffic control (ATC) centers. These procedures facilitate communication, data sharing, and operational planning.
1. Pre-Flight Planning
Before departure, airlines submit flight plans that include route details, estimated times, and aircraft information. These plans are reviewed and approved by relevant authorities to ensure compatibility with air traffic management systems.
2. Use of Standardized Communication Protocols
Clear and standardized communication between pilots and ATC is essential. International standards, such as those set by the International Civil Aviation Organization (ICAO), are used to minimize misunderstandings and ensure safety.
3. Real-Time Traffic Monitoring
Air traffic control centers continuously monitor flights using radar and satellite data. This real-time tracking allows for timely adjustments in routing and altitude to prevent congestion and collisions.
International Cooperation and Agreements
Effective coordination relies heavily on international agreements and cooperation. Organizations like ICAO facilitate the development of common standards and procedures that member countries adopt to streamline cross-border air traffic management.
Examples of International Procedures
- Implementing standardized flight plan formats
- Sharing radar and traffic data among countries
- Coordinating airspace usage through regional agreements
- Conducting joint training and simulations for crisis management
These procedures help reduce delays, improve safety, and optimize the use of limited airspace resources worldwide.
Challenges and Future Developments
Despite established procedures, challenges such as geopolitical tensions, technological disparities, and increasing air traffic volumes persist. Future developments aim to incorporate advanced automation, AI, and improved international data sharing to enhance coordination further.
